Summer Reading Programs


Barnes and Noble: Grades 1-6 can get a brand new free book after they read 8 books and fill out a very simple form.

HEB: After kids read 10 books they get a free T-shirt and some prizes. (I have done this with my 6 month old baby and still got a prize)

Half Price Books: Kids 12 and under can read for 15 minutes a day and get a $3.00 shoping card. This can be done every week! I have always been able to find a small used chapter book that is under 3 dollars.

Austin Library: (almost every library in North America has a summer reading program for kids.)Read at your childs own pace and get a free book after you complete your goals. http://www.austinsummerreading.org/
